arsenal start Rob Holding instead of William Saliba in today’s Premier League London derby against Crystal Palace.

Saliba was eliminated early during Thursday’s shock Europa League defeat by Sporting Lisbon because of a back problem.

The centre-back, who started every league game for Arsenal this season, was set to be assessed in hopes of being able to play this weekend.

However, later reports from France stated that Saliba is waiting in the treatment room for several weeks and will not participate in international duty.

Arteta heads for Holding today alongside Gabriel Magalhaes at centre-back in Saliba’s absence, with January signing Jakub Kiwior on the bench, along with fellow defenders Kieran Tierney and youngster Reuell Walters.

Takehiro Tomiyasu was also injured against Sporting and his injury seems serious. The right-back injured his knee and left the Emirates Stadium on crutches.

Arsenal are making the expected changes after Thursday night’s loss to Sporting as they welcome Palace, who are now managerless firing Gunners icon Patrick Vieira on Friday.

Martin Odegaard and Thomas Partey return to midfield, while Bukayo Saka rejoins an attack led by the fit again Leandro Trossard with Gabriel Jesus back on the bench.

Eddie Nketiah and Mohamed Elneny meanwhile stay aside.
